As spring sweeps across the Chinese mainland, the landscapes burst into life with blossoming flowers. In recent years, rapeseed flower viewing has become a highlight of spring tourism. Traditionally, the golden rapeseed fields have drawn countless visitors eager to immerse themselves in seas of yellow blooms.
But now, scientific innovation is adding a splash of color to these fields. In Xinjin, located in southwest China’s Sichuan Province, researchers have developed multi-colored rapeseed flowers, transforming the countryside into a vibrant tapestry of hues. These colorful fields are not only a feast for the eyes but also a catalyst for boosting rural tourism.
The introduction of multi-colored rapeseed flowers has sparked new business opportunities. Local entrepreneurs have created unique experiences like the “Flower-field Hotpot” and “Flower-field Cafe,” allowing visitors to enjoy local cuisine amid the blooming fields. These ventures have enriched the rural tourism experience, bringing diversity and vitality to the local economy.
Young people and travelers from all over are flocking to Xinjin to capture the breathtaking views and share them on social media.
